The scientist often attributed with forming the scientific method is Sir Francis Bacon, an English philosopher and statesman. He emphasized the importance of empirical evidence, experimentation, and inductive reasoning in the pursuit of scientific knowledge.

The formation of hypotheses in the scientific method involves generating testable explanations or predictions based on observations or prior knowledge. It is a critical step in setting up controlled experiments to investigate the validity of the hypothesis and ultimately draw scientific conclusions.

Francis Bacon is typically credited as the first Englishman to suggest rational steps for a scientific method in his work "Novum Organum" in the early 17th century. In it, he outlined a systematic approach to experimentation, observation, and reasoning to acquire knowledge about the natural world. Bacon's emphasis on empirical evidence and inductive reasoning laid the foundation for the scientific method as we know it today.
Both Descartes and Bacon had their own step-by-step methods that were created before the scientific method. The idea of answering scientific or philosophical questions in an ordered way came from Bacon and Descartes and is the basis of the scientific method.

The scientific work of Sir Francis Bacon relied heavily on observation, experimentation, and inductive reasoning. He is often regarded as the father of the scientific method, advocating for a systematic approach to inquiry that emphasizes empirical evidence and the collection of data through experiments. Bacon's ideas laid the groundwork for modern scientific practices, encouraging scientists to draw general conclusions from specific observations. His emphasis on inductive reasoning marked a significant shift from the deductive reasoning prevalent in earlier scientific thought.
